Abstract
A method and apparatus for controlling a machine. The method includes providing a control panel having a plurality of control switches and respectively associated illumination means, identifying by illumination which of the control switches are selectable for control at any given moment; and choosing an operation by selecting one of the control switches whose associated illumination means is illuminated. The apparatus includes a controller and software for controlling a machine. Control switches and associated illumination means are operatively connected to the controller. Selectable switches are identified by illumination of the illumination means associated with the selectable switches.
